* [InstCombine] Invert `add A, sext(B) --> sub A, zext(B)` canonicalization ↵Roman Lebedev2019-12-051-10/+10
| |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| (to `sub A, zext B -> add A, sext B`) Summary: D68408 proposes to greatly improve our negation sinking abilities. But in current canonicalization, we produce `sub A, zext(B)`, which we will consider non-canonical and try to sink that negation, undoing the existing canonicalization. So unless we explicitly stop producing previous canonicalization, we will have two conflicting folds, and will end up endlessly looping. This inverts canonicalization, and adds back the obvious fold that we'd miss: * `sub [nsw] Op0, sext/zext (bool Y) -> add [nsw] Op0, zext/sext (bool Y)` https://rise4fun.com/Alive/xx4 * `sext(bool) + C -> bool ? C - 1 : C` https://rise4fun.com/Alive/fBl It is obvious that `@ossfuzz_9880()` / `@lshr_out_of_range()`/`@ashr_out_of_range()` (oss-fuzz 4871) are no longer folded as much, though those aren't really worrying. * [InstCombine] canonicalize add/sub with boolSanjay Patel2019-02-241-8/+8
| | | | | | | | | | | | | | | | | | | | | | | add A, sext(B) --> sub A, zext(B) We have to choose 1 of these forms, so I'm opting for the zext because that's easier for value tracking. The backend should be prepared for this change after: D57401 rL353433 This is also a preliminary step towards reducing the amount of bit hackery that we do in IR to optimize icmp/select. That should be waiting to happen at a later optimization stage. The seeming regression in the fuzzer test was discussed in: D58359 We were only managing that fold in instcombine by luck, and other passes should be able to deal with that better anyway. llvm-svn: 354748

* Remove a instcombine transform that (no longer?) makes sense:Evan Cheng2012-06-261-26/+13
| |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| // C - zext(bool) -> bool ? C - 1 : C if (ZExtInst *ZI = dyn_cast<ZExtInst>(Op1)) if (ZI->getSrcTy()->isIntegerTy(1)) return SelectInst::Create(ZI->getOperand(0), SubOne(C), C); This ends up forming sext i1 instructions that codegen to terrible code. e.g. int blah(_Bool x, _Bool y) { return (x - y) + 1; } => movzbl %dil, %eax movzbl %sil, %ecx shll $31, %ecx sarl $31, %ecx leal 1(%rax,%rcx), %eax ret Without the rule, llvm now generates: movzbl %sil, %ecx movzbl %dil, %eax incl %eax subl %ecx, %eax ret It also helps with ARM (and pretty much any target that doesn't have a sext i1 :-). The transformation was done as part of Eli's r75531. He has given the ok to remove it. rdar://11748024 llvm-svn: 159230
